Inspect and Identify Signs of Cooler Leak

Start by parking your car on a level surface and engaging the parking brake. Open the hood and visually inspect the transmission cooler lines and fittings for evident leaks, cracks, or corrosion. Use a flashlight to trace any puddles or drips underneath your vehicle, especially where the cooler lines run. Remember, small leaks can be sneaky, resembling faint oily spots that increase over time. One time, I spotted a tiny drop near the radiator fan shroud that initially seemed insignificant but turned out to be the first sign of a failing cooler line after a quick test drive.

Drain the Transmission Fluid Safely

Before disconnecting anything, drain the transmission fluid to prevent spillage. Place a drain pan under the transmission pan drain plug or petcock valve. Use a wrench to loosen the plug carefully—think of it as releasing the ‘blood’ of your transmission. Collect the fluid and set it aside, remembering that transmission fluid is hot and corrosive, so safety gloves and goggles are recommended. This step ensures you’ll avoid a messy cleanup and prevents contamination of the new fluid during repair.

Disconnect and Replace Damaged Cooler Lines

Carefully disconnect the damaged cooler lines using the appropriate wrenches. Take note of the routing and size to ensure accurate replacement. Once disconnected, examine the fittings for damage or corrosion. In my experience, replacing rubber hoses with reinforced metal lines often prevents future leaks. When installing the new lines, lubricate the fittings with a bit of transmission fluid for a snug fit. Think of this process as replacing the veins of your transmission—smooth, secure connections mean better health.

Refill and Bleed the Transmission System

After completing the line replacement, refill the transmission with the manufacturer-recommended fluid—consult your owner’s manual or service guide. Use a funnel to pour the fluid into the transmission dipstick tube, filling slowly to avoid overflows. Once filled, start the engine and let it idle, shifting through the gears to circulate the new fluid and bleed out any air pockets. Your goal is a smooth, consistent transmission operation, much like tuning a musical instrument for optimal sound. Check for leaks during this process; if none appear, proceed to the next step.

Test Drive for Performance and Check for Leaks

Drive your vehicle on varied terrains, paying attention to shifting smoothness and any unusual noises. Reinspect the cooler lines and fittings after driving—look for new leaks, drips, or puddles. If everything looks clean and the vehicle performs well, you’ve successfully tackled the repair. Keeping Your Car in Top Shape: The Tools That Make the Difference

Maintaining a vehicle’s performance over time requires more than just routine checks; it hinges on having the right tools and understanding their proper use. As someone deeply involved in auto repair, I can attest that precision tools not only save you time but also prevent costly mistakes. For instance, I rely heavily on a high-quality scan tool like the Autel MaxiSys MS909, which allows me to access all of a vehicle’s electronic control modules quickly and accurately. This device is invaluable for diagnosing issues like sensor malfunctions or transmission irregularities without guesswork, enabling proactive repairs that extend your car’s lifespan.

Another essential piece of equipment is a digital multimeter calibrated for automotive use. I prefer the Fluke 116—their accuracy and durability make it perfect for testing electrical systems, checking battery health, or verifying wiring integrity. Proper use of a multimeter can help you identify unseen problems, such as intermittent voltage drops that might lead to component failure over time. Remember, understanding voltage patterns can reveal issues before they escalate into more significant, expensive repairs.

For fluid-related maintenance, a vacuum pump like the ATEQ VT36 simplifies the process of bleeding brakes or evacuating transmission fluid systems. I personally use it when replacing transmission cooler lines because it ensures thorough fluid removal and replacement, reducing the risk of air entrapment. This precise method helps maintain optimal hydraulic pressure and prolongs component life, especially in systems sensitive to air contamination.
